I think I missed your original post. Is Lauren a Leopard gecko? Many
things can cause a gecko to loose weight and not eat. I would make sure the
cage is at the proper temperature and that the substrate is not something
that the gecko could eat and become blocked.
What you may want to do is hand feed this gecko, so that you can obtain a
fecal. I usually use Emeraid II (bird feeding food) or A/D canned dog/cat
food. Your vet will probably have these products. I suck the food into a
syringe and tickle the corner of the geckos mouth until they open. I then
slowly feed 1/2 -1cc a feeding (for a leopard or fat tail gecko).
Once you are able to get a fecal sample, you might want to ask your vet if
they can check it for crypto. I know at our practice we are seeing a lot
more of this parasite in snakes and geckos. The parasite is very small and
the person doing the fecal needs to know what they are looking for. It is
also shed intermittently, so not all samples will show positive. You might
have to do a few samples to get a positive result.
